Chouriki Sentai Ohranger: S1 E15 - O Friend!! Sleep Hotly!!

Shout! Factory TV presents Super Sentai! Yuji encounters a Machine Beast created from the remnants of Baranoia's failures whose only desire is to destroy Bacchus Wrath!

